5112. Isoamylamine

Nomenclature

CAS number: 107-85-7
3-Methyl-1-butanamine; isopentylamine; isobutylcarbylamine; 3-methylbutylamine.
C5H13N; mol wt 87.16.
C 68.90%, H 15.03%, N 16.07%.

Description and references

Prepn from acetamide + isoamylbromide: Erickson, Ber. 59B, 2665 (1926); from α-methylhydroxylamine + isoamylmagnesium chloride: Sheverdina, Kocheshkov, J. Gen. Chem. USSR 8, 1825 (1938). Isoln from Clostridium sordelli: Prevot, Thouvenot, Ann. Inst. Pasteur 103, 925 (1962).

Chemical structure

Properties

Colorless liq; strong ammonia odor. d18 0.751. bp 95°. nD18 1.4096. Miscible with water, alcohol, chloroform, ether.

Derivative

Hydrochloride.

Nomenclature

CAS number: 541-23-1
C5H13N.HCl; mol wt 123.62.
C 48.58%, H 11.41%, N 11.33%, Cl 28.68%.

Properties

Crystals from acetone, mp 215°. One gram dissolves in 0.5 ml water, 20 ml chloroform; sol in alcohol.

Caution

Irritating to skin, mucous membranes.
